edbdata_import_fail.go 1.1 KB

1234567891011121314151617181920212223242526272829
  1. package models
  2. import (
  3. "eta_gn/eta_api/global"
  4. "eta_gn/eta_api/utils"
  5. )
  6. type EdbdataImportFail struct {
  7. Id int `gorm:"column:id;primaryKey;autoIncrement" description:"主键ID"`
  8. ClassifyName string `gorm:"column:classify_name" description:"分类名称"`
  9. CreateDate string `gorm:"column:create_date" description:"创建日期"`
  10. SecName string `gorm:"column:sec_name" description:"部门名称"`
  11. Close string `gorm:"column:close" description:"关闭状态"`
  12. Remark string `gorm:"column:remark" description:"备注"`
  13. SysUserId string `gorm:"column:sys_user_id" description:"系统用户ID"`
  14. Frequency string `gorm:"column:frequency" description:"频率"`
  15. Unit string `gorm:"column:unit" description:"单位"`
  16. }
  17. func MultiAddEdbdataImportFail(items []*EdbdataImportFail) (err error) {
  18. err = global.DmSQL["edb"].CreateInBatches(items, utils.MultiAddNum).Error
  19. return err
  20. }
  21. func DelEdbDataImportFail(userId int) (err error) {
  22. sql := `delete from edbdata_import_fail where sys_user_id=?`
  23. err = global.DmSQL["edb"].Exec(sql, userId).Error
  24. return err
  25. }